Output c76a5eef129c154c7e52256df6b0abc01bb7223f2e28c4d64dfb06fed67c85cf:21

value
657697
script pubkey
OP_0 OP_PUSHBYTES_20 ccfa1f413804630b693786b4ed0448e32f565056
address
bc1qenap7sfcq33sk6fhs66w6pzguvh4v5zk6xx9c4
transaction
c76a5eef129c154c7e52256df6b0abc01bb7223f2e28c4d64dfb06fed67c85cf
spent
true